Whenever increasing Emulated CPU Clock to achieve a better frame rate on Spider-Man:The Movie it does what it is supposed to, while adding crackling audio. Crackling audio is not present when running at normal Emulated CPU Clock speeds. I have googled around and have found nothing on this. Game is at 100% speed at all times, regardless of the CPU Clock speeds. Any help or info on this would be greatly appreciated!

I am running a Ryzen 7 5800x with an RTX 2060 in case that makes any difference in why I am getting the results I am getting.
